Rick,

I sent an e-mail to three local school corporations stating what problems I can solvde using en-cap. One corporation call in a few days and said they were having the same problems i claimed to be able to solve. I was asked to do test cleanings in all five schools and provide an estimate, meet with the Principals and answer any questions the custodians may have. The latter was the challange.

I got the call friday that they wanted to do business with me. I was very humbled and thankful.

I appreciate the opportunity Cimex/Releasit had given me. It has truly changed the way I offer Carpet Cleaning. After I get this first "big" under my belt I plan to take my show on the road.

I will need an additional Cimax and a cargo van. I'll call monday to get information on leasing. I also plan to see my banker for interest rates.

I never will forget when I was attending one of Ed York's Cleaning College in Vancover, he had his people bring in ice and water from the hotel meeting room and dump in into the portable extractor (if you can imange ice cubes floating ot top of the water in the solution tank) and then they proceeded to clean a nasty sofa with it. Several times in the last month I have had to clean an investor rental home that had no hot water and it still can be done. I am always reminded of Ed in times like that. One of the points being, you did not need a fire breathing truckmount to clean with. The universal solvent (Water) Agitation and the right chemicals were more important. Ed was always challenging the way you thought about cleaning and your business. I first met him after joining SCT when it was headquatered in Greenville, South Carolina. He was one of the most intelligent person I have ever met in this industry. I am sure Paul Lucas of ChemMax would agree.
